Living in one of Charlotte’s best suburbs comes with a few advantages, and one of them is the fact that the town has a low violent crime rate. With two incidents per 1,000 residents, the town is safer than the state average of almost four incidents per 1,000 residents. However, things get a bit worrying about Matthews’s property crime rate, which is significantly higher.
The property crime rate is at around 29 incidents per 1,000 residents, which is higher than the North Carolina average that sits at 25 incidents per 1,000 residents. The town holds plenty of retail shops and great dining places, which might be one of the reasons why property crimes tend to be higher because shoplifting and theft occur more often than not.
